About P. J. Azor

P. J. Azor is a scholar working on Genetics, Equine, Cell Biology, Molecular Biology and Ecology, Evolution, Behavior and Systematics, having authored 34 papers that have together received 381 indexed citations. Recurring topics across this work include Genetic and phenotypic traits in livestock (21 papers), Genetic Mapping and Diversity in Plants and Animals (13 papers), Genetic diversity and population structure (12 papers), Veterinary Equine Medical Research (7 papers), Genetic and Clinical Aspects of Sex Determination and Chromosomal Abnormalities (4 papers), melanin and skin pigmentation (4 papers), Meat and Animal Product Quality (2 papers) and Animal Genetics and Reproduction (2 papers). The work is most often cited by research in Equine (87 citations), Genetics (257 citations), Cell Biology (114 citations), Animal Science and Zoology (59 citations) and Sensory Systems (16 citations). P. J. Azor has collaborated with scholars based in Spain, Argentina and Switzerland. Frequent co-authors include M. Valera, A. Molina, Samantha A. Brooks, Ernest Bailey, Tosso Leeb, Pierre-André Poncet, Bianca Haase, Meike Mevissen, Dominik Burger and Angela Schlumbaum. Their work appears in journals such as Livestock Science, Animals, Animal Genetics, PLoS Genetics and Equine Veterinary Journal.
